Set a Budget
Before you start browsing for used cars, it is important to establish a clear budget. Determine how much you are willing to spend on a used car, factoring in additional costs such as taxes, registration fees, and insurance. Setting a realistic budget makes sure that you are only looking at vehicles within your price range, which helps avoid any financial strain down the road.

Research Your Options
When it comes to how to buy a used car, doing thorough research is key. Start by making a list of the makes and models you are interested in. Take the time to read reviews, check reliability ratings, and compare prices for similar vehicles within your budget. Researching your options will help you identify the best value for the car that meets your needs.
As you explore different makes and models, be sure to also consider the vehicle's history. Look into factors such as accident history, ownership records, and whether it has had any major repairs.

Inspect the Vehicle
Before committing to any used car purchase, it is important to conduct a thorough inspection. Check the exterior for any signs of damage, rust, or wear. Inspect the tires, lights, and windows to check that everything is functioning properly.
A reliable dealership will allow you to take the car for a test drive and perform your own inspection. Do not hesitate to ask questions about the car's history and request any available documentation. Ask for service records to learn more about the car's maintenance and if it has had any major issues in the past.
Take a Test Drive
Taking a test drive is a vital part of the used car buying process. It gives you the opportunity to experience how the car handles on the road. Pay attention to how it drives, including the comfort level, braking performance, and overall handling.
During the test drive, listen carefully for any strange noises or vibrations. These could indicate underlying mechanical issues. Additionally, test all of the vehicle's features, such as the air conditioning, radio, and power windows, to make certain that they are all functioning as expected.
Negotiate the Price
Once you have found a used car you are interested in, it is time to negotiate the price. A reputable car dealership in Castle Rock will offer competitive pricing, but there is often room for negotiation. Be prepared to discuss any imperfections you noticed during the inspection or test drive, and use these as leverage to lower the price if needed.
Consider checking the market value of the car using online tools. This will give you a fair idea of what the vehicle is worth and help you negotiate a price that is in line with current market trends.
Review the Vehicle History Report
Before finalizing your purchase, be sure to review the vehicle history report. This report presents valuable information about the car's previous owners, any accidents it may have been involved in, and its maintenance records. Dealerships often offer these reports for free, offering transparency and reassurance.
If any red flags come up in the vehicle history report, such as multiple accidents or a history of major repairs, it may be worth reconsidering the purchase. Trustworthy dealerships will be upfront about the car's history and will not shy away from providing this important documentation.
Understand the Warranty
Another important step in how to buy a used car is understanding the warranty options available. While used cars typically do not come with the same warranty as new vehicles, many dealerships offer limited warranties on pre-owned cars. Be sure to ask about any warranties or service contracts that may be included with the vehicle.
Some dealerships offer certified pre-owned vehicles, which come with extended warranties and additional benefits. These warranties can bring peace of mind, knowing that you are covered in case of any unexpected repairs. Be sure to read the fine print of any warranty or service contract before signing the purchase agreement.
Finalize the Paperwork
Once you have completed all of the necessary steps, it is time to finalize the paperwork and complete the purchase. This includes signing the sales agreement, arranging financing, and paying for the car. Make sure to carefully review all documents to see to it that the terms are clear and that there are no hidden fees.
After the paperwork is completed, the dealership will give you the title and registration for the vehicle. You will also receive any maintenance records and warranty information. Once everything is in order, you can drive away in your new-to-you car with confidence.
